On the menu was a red lentil (masoor daal) cooked with some basic tadka spices. I love myself some daal with extra crunch. Added roasted cauliflower and Swiss chard. For color and variation in crunch
.
.
The Palak paneer got a finishing tadka for heeng that I picked up on my recent trip. That boxes powder stands nowhere near this freshly pounded gems of joy
.
.
Raita recipe - yogurt, cucumber, orange zest and juice, powdered sugar, freshly ground cumin powder. It’s magical. Try it.
